Medical Expert Shares Cancer Research and Recommendations at Anti-Aging Fellowship


SANTA ROSA, Calif., March 21, 2011 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Dr. Isaac Eliaz lectures on Integrative approaches to Prostate Cancer at the American Academy of Anti-Aging Medicine (A4M) Integrative Oncology Fellowship. The fellowship, held in Boca Raton, Florida, brought together experts, and works to educate physicians, and scientists on all issues related to Integrative Cancer care.

During the event Dr. Isaac Eliaz, Medical Director of Amitabha Clinic, shared his research and recommendations on integrative approaches to prostate issues, primarily focusing on the treatment and prevention of prostate cancer.
